@charset "utf-8";
/* CSS Document */

.et_pb_fullwidth_menu_0.et_pb_fullwidth_menu, .et_pb_section_13.et_pb_section { display:none !important;}


.Section { padding:75px 0 !important; position:relative;}
.Section.PeacePrograms   { z-index:auto !important;}
.Section.BlueBg  { top:-150px !important; position:relative; /*  background-attachment:fixed !important;*/ z-index:3px !important; padding-top:125px !important;  }
.Section h3 { color:#666 !important;}

.h1.blank:before { display:none !important;}
#menu-menu-upgrade3 li a { padding-right:0px !important;}
#menu-menu-upgrade3 li { margin-right:20px !important;}
#menu-menu-upgrade3 li ul{ border-top:0px !important;}
#menu-menu-upgrade3 li ul li a, #menu-menu-upgrade3 li:hover ul li a, #menu-menu-upgrade3 li:hover ul li:hover a { border:0px !important;}
#menu-menu-upgrade3 li a{border-bottom:solid 5px transparent !important; }
#menu-menu-upgrade3 li:hover a{border-bottom:solid 5px #FF854D!important; }
#menu-menu-upgrade3 li.btnDonate a {color: #FF854D!important;
    font-weight: 700;
    padding: 13px 50px !important;
    margin-left: 40px;
    margin-top: -15px;
    border: 2px solid #FF854D !important;
    border-radius: 9px;
    -webkit-border-radius: 9px;
    -moz-border-radius: 9px; }
#menu-menu-upgrade3 li ul li a { padding:10px !important;}
.et_pb_text_0 h1:before, .h1:before {content:' '; background: #FF854D; border-radius: 2px; width:200px; height:5px; position:absolute; top:-35px !important; left:50%; margin-left:-100px;}
.et_pb_text_0 h1, .h1, h1 { font-family: Roboto !important ; font-style: normal;font-weight: bold;font-size: 36px !important; line-height: 55px !important;/* identical to box height, or 153% */text-align: center; color: #000000; margin-top:0px !important;}
.et_pb_cta_1.et_pb_promo .et_pb_promo_description div {font-family: Roboto; color:#000 !important;}
p {font-family: Roboto !important ; font-size:18px; }
.Para, .Para p {font-size: 20px !important ; font-family: Roboto !important ;  color:#333 !important; font-weight:normal !important;
line-height: 30px !important ;}

.PeacePrograms  h1.h1, .PeacePrograms p { color:#FFF !important;}
.ContactForm .et_contact_bottom_container { float:none !important; display:block !important; text-align:center !important;}
.ContactForm .et_contact_bottom_container .et_pb_contact_right { display:block !important; text-align:center !important;}
.ContactForm .et_contact_bottom_container .et_pb_contact_submit {background:#000000 !important; border-radius:10px !important; color:#FFF !important; text-align:ccenter !important; border:0ps !important; outline:none !important; isplay:block !important; margin-top:20px !important; font-size:18px !important;}

.ContactForm  p.et_pb_contact_field { margin-bottom:40px !important;}

.TestimonialCard .et_pb_testimonial_portrait { width: 192px !important;    height: 192px !important;    border-radius: 100px !important; margin-right:75px !important;}
.TestimonialCard .et_pb_testimonial { background:none !important;}
.TestimonialCard .et_pb_testimonial:before { display:none !important;}
.TestimonialCard .et_pb_testimonial .et_pb_testimonial_content p { font-size: 26px  !important; line-height: 40px  !important;}
.TestimonialCard .et_pb_testimonial .et_pb_testimonial_author{ font-size: 18px  !important; line-height: 30px  !important; font-weight:bold !important; margin-top:0px !important;}

.TestimonialCard .et_pb_testimonial .et_pb_testimonial_meta{ font-size: 18px  !important; line-height: 30px  !important;}


.ImpactStories .Card { background: #FFFFFF !important; box-shadow: 2px 2px 20px rgba(0, 0, 0, 0.150432) !important;}
.ImpactStories .Card iframe {height:285px !important;}
.ImpactStories .Card .fluid-width-video-wrapper { padding-top:285px !important;}
.ImpactStories .Card .Photo { width:100% !important;}
.ImpactStories .Card .Details { padding:20px !important; font-size: 18px !important; line-height: 24px !important;  color:#000 !important;}
.ImpactStories .Card .Details span { font-weight:bold !important; display:block !important; margin-bottom:0px !important;}

.WhiteBox {background: #FFFFFF;box-shadow: 2px 2px 20px rgba(0, 0, 0, 0.150432);border-radius: 14px; padding:75px 60px !important; margin-top:35px !important; z-index:2 !important; }
.IconBox h1.h1, .WhiteBox h1.h1 {margin-top:35px  !important; color:#000 !important;}
.PeacePrograms .WhiteBox .Para, .PeacePrograms .WhiteBox  .Para p{color:#333 !important;}
.IconBox .et_pb_text_inner , .IconBox p {text-align:center !important; font-size: 18px !important ; font-family: Roboto !important ;  color:#333 !important;
line-height: 30px !important ;  color:#000 !important;}

.WhiteBox h2 {font-family: Roboto;
font-style: normal;
font-weight: 500;
font-size: 28px !important;
line-height: 36px !important; color:#FF854D !important; margin-bottom:20px !important;}

.WhiteBox p {
font-family: Roboto !important;
font-style: normal;
font-weight: normal !important;
font-size: 20px !important;
line-height: 30px !important;  color:#333 !important; width: 90%;}

.WhiteBox ul { margin:0; padding:0;}
.WhiteBox ul li {
font-family: Roboto !important;
font-style: normal;
font-weight: normal !important;
font-size: 20px !important;
line-height: 30px !important; color:#333 !important;}
.Bars .et_pb_counter_amount {
    background-color: #ff630f;
}
.CopyRight, .CopyRight p {font-weight: normal !important;
font-size: 18px !important;
line-height: 30px !important;}
.Bars .et_pb_counter_container { border-radius:5px !important;}
.Bars .et_pb_counter_amount {background:#FF854D !important;}

.ListWithIcon{ margin:0; padding:0;}
.ListWithIcon  li {font-weight: normal !important; vertical-align:middle;
font-size: 22px;
line-height: 36px;
color: #333; list-style:none; margin:15px 0;}
.ListWithIcon li img { vertical-align: middle;
    margin-right: 30px;}
	
	.SimpleList{ margin:0; padding:0;}
.SimpleList  li {font-weight: normal; vertical-align:middle;font-size: 18px;line-height: 30px;color: #333; list-style:none; margin:15px 0; position:relative; padding-left:20px;}
.SimpleList li:before { content:''; background:#696969; border-radius:10px; width:10px; height:10px; position:absolute; left:-20px; top:10px; }
	
	.IconBox .et_pb_column_1_3 { text-align:center !important; font-family: Roboto !important ; font-size: 22px;line-height: 40px;}
	
	.Bars li span {font-size: 16px !important;}
	
	.Hidden { display:none !important;}
	footer .et_pb_menu .et-menu li { position:relative; padding-left:20px !important;}
footer .et_pb_menu .et-menu li:before {content:'-'; position:absolute; left:5px; top:2px; font-weight:bold; color:#FFF !important;}
footer .FooterCopyright { font-size:18px !important; font-weight:normal !important;}
.OnlyDesktop { display:block !important;}
.OnlyMobile { display:none !important;}
@media only screen and (max-width: 1002px){
.Section { padding:25px 0 !important;}
h1.h1.blank	 { display:none !important;}
.WhiteBox { padding:25px !important;}
.PeacePrograms  { background-size:cover !important;}
.ListWithIcon li {text-align:center !important;}
.ListWithIcon li img { display:block !important; margin:30px auto 10px auto !important;}
.et_pb_testimonial_content, .et_pb_testimonial_author, .et_pb_testimonial_meta { text-align: center !important;}
.TestimonialCard .et_pb_testimonial_portrait { margin:0 auto 15px auto !important;}
.OnlyDesktop { display:none !important;}
.OnlyMobile { display:block !important;}
}
	

